condition30 condition30condition30










zenstringslogo

ZenStrings is Condtion30’s music engine.  Based on the company’s proprietary technology,  ZenStrings composes complex musical in real time based on user inputs. 
Features:

  1. Fully interactive

Because the ZenStrings engine generates music, rather than playing back pre-composed music loops, users can easily change their songs by simply altering one or more inputs.

  1. ZenStrings creates the actual composition, making it easy to use for all users, even those with no musical training

In a traditional approach to music composition, a composer pre-specifies all aspects of the piece such as rhythm, melody, and dynamics. ZenStrings automates music creation so that users only have to input simple instructions to start the musical composition. 

  1. Real-time music generation

ZenStrings music is generated in real time, dispensing with pre-composed MIDI or audio files that tax memory resources.

  1. Varied musical compositions

ZenStrings easily creates various compositions, each unique to its specific inputs.

  1. Quick, simple modifications

ZenStrings’ algorithms generate a variety of dynamic behaviors, including true complexity.  Modifications are simply parameter changes – each requires only a few keystrokes or icon selections.

  1. Psychoacoustic principles embedded in algorithms, making music sound more realistic

Due to the nature of the ZenStrings algorithms, human beings can intuitively identify that the music being generated is neither entirely random nor overly predictable, unless the composer selects such constraints.

  1. Completely deterministic

The ZenStrings engine generates musical output which is completely deterministic, unlike other more random music generation systems. These other systems typically derive their initial input using a random seed value. For any given set of parameters, ZenStrings-generated music plays exactly the same way every time.

  1. Generates any required length of music

ZenStrings can be used to create essentially ‘infinite’ compositions – so that a song can be as short or as long as the user desires.



For more information contact: Laura Jo Gunter, CEO:  laurajo@condition30.com

Or Gary Bourgeois, Complexity Engineer: gary@condtion30.com

 
condition30